Position: Full Stack and Embedded Software Engineer (Counter UAS)

Company Description

Pheratech Systems builds decentralized swarm intelligence for autonomous systems. Our edge-based autonomy enables each unit to process its own sensor data, plan locally, and communicate over a mesh network, eliminating the need for a central controller and reducing points of failure. This approach allows for effective multi-agent coordination in low-connectivity, high-complexity environments. Pheratech’s autonomy stack supports real-time decision-making and cooperative behaviors across drones, ground vehicles, and maritime platforms, scaling across various missions such as perimeter security and infrastructure inspection.

As a venture-backed company, advised by leaders from defense and homeland security, we’re actively deploying systems and venturing into commercial markets.

Responsibilities
  • Build robust detection and tracking pipelines using multiple sensors (RF, vision, lidar, IMU) for small UAS in cluttered environments.
  • Develop lightweight onboard models for classification and short-horizon intent prediction, optimized for embedded accelerators.
  • Design engagement decision logic that prioritizes safety, escalation checks, and mission rules.
  • Implement safe mitigation behaviors focused on containment, recovery, and safe disruption rather than destructive action.
  • Integrate perception and decision modules into flight software and autonomy stacks; maintain deterministic real-time behavior.
  • Lead field tests and analysis; produce reproducible datasets and post-flight reports to improve system performance.
  • Work with ops, legal, and compliance teams to ensure all capabilities meet regulatory and contractual requirements.
  • Document architecture, parameter choices, and tradeoffs; mentor teammates and help grow the C-UAS capability.
Minimum Qualifications
  • BS in Electrical, Computer, Aerospace Engineering, Robotics, or related field; MS preferred.
  • 3+ years building perception, embedded ML, or autonomy for UAVs or related robotics systems.
  • Experience deploying models on embedded platforms (Jetson, Orin, Coral) and integrating with ROS/ROS2 or equivalent.
  • Strong software skills in C++ and Python, and practical knowledge of real-time/embedded constraints.
  • Field test experience with UAVs and sensor integration.
Preferred Qualifications
  • Background in RF sensing or signal processing, or experience with lightweight sensor fusion.
  • Familiarity with airspace rules, safety case development, and non-destructive mitigation approaches.
  • Experience with multi-agent coordination and constrained autonomy.
  • Ability to work in a fast, cross-functional startup environment and to run flight tests end to end.
